
House GOP Group Calls for Columbia President's Resignation
House Speaker Mike Johnson led a group of Republican colleagues on Wednesday, calling for Columbia University President Minouche Shafik to resign her post after talking with Jewish students at the college about verbal and physical attacks against them.
Competing with shouting anti-Israel protesters on the Columbia campus, the delegation ripped the demonstrators for "supporting Hamas" and President Shafik for not being able to protect her Jewish students, also alleging her inaction amid calls to do so.
